0

我通过 Xcode 9.4 将我的应用程序重新上传到了 TestFlight,但是在 IOS 11 中的测试飞行构建的闪屏后它不断崩溃,而相同的测试飞行在 IOS 10 中工作。当在设备中的 Adhoc 构建中运行时,它工作正常,没有任何问题。

我上次提交的 Xcode 9.2 在包括 11.4 在内的所有 IOS 设备上都运行良好。

当我从 Organizer 获得崩溃日志时,它会说,App 在一条语句上崩溃,例如 self.viewInput.refreshRewardCount(current: current, max: max)当应用启动时,当前和最大值分别以 0 和 50 静态传递。

另外,我还检查了我的 LLVM 和 Swift 编译器的优化标志,这些标志已正确设置为我的其他应用程序,人们也在堆栈上建议。

帮我解决这个问题。

谢谢

4

1 回答 1

0

我们以前遇到过这个。如果您还没有解决这个问题,请尝试使用 ImageOptim(从 Mac AppStore 下载)并优化您的所有图像。iOS 9 有一个错误,它无法处理 PNG 文件的某些元数据。

于 2018-09-24T17:43:23.927 回答